Revelstoke RCMP confirm one dead in Trans Canada crash

Sep 13, 2018 | 3:42 PM

REVELSTOKE, B.C. — A 30 year old Maple Ridge man is dead following a two-vehicle collision 12 kilometres west of Revelstoke on the Trans Canada Highway.

Revelstoke RCMP Sgt. Rob Haney says the crash occurred just after 8:00 p.m. Tuesday night (Sept. 11).

“The collision involved an eastbound GMC Sierra pickup truck and an empty westbound Mack semi-trailer B train unit,” he says. “The 30 year old male driver of the GMC from Maple Ridge, B.C. was pronounced deceased at the scene.”

Haney says the 40 year old male driver of the Mack truck was not injured.
